<emphasis>Log</emphasis> - <acronym>ZFS</acronym> Log Devices, also known as <acronym>ZFS</acronym> Intent Log (<link linkend="zfs-term-zil"><acronym>ZIL</acronym></link>) move the intent log from the regular pool devices to a dedicated device, typically an <acronym>SSD</acronym>. Having a dedicated log device can significantly improve the performance of applications with a high volume of synchronous writes, especially databases. Log devices can be mirrored, but <acronym>RAID-Z</acronym> is not supported. If multiple log devices are used, writes will be load balanced across them.
